Go out of node editor. Select mix material with all materials connected to it.connartist wrote:There's probably a reason this is not default, but is there any way to duplicate a connection of nodes in the node editor and maintain all the connections? Right now I'm trying to duplicate a mix material 12 times and Im having to duplicate, then reconnect the structure before making my changes. Thanks!
Ctrl+c - ctrl+V.
Give all new materials new names.
Go back to node editor. Everything should be fine.
